Understanding the Foundations of Effective Workflow Design
Before diving into the mechanics of implementation, it’s essential to grasp the underlying principles of effective workflow design. A well-designed workflow isn’t merely a sequence of tasks; it's a carefully considered orchestration of activities, responsibilities, and dependencies. The initial stage involves a thorough analysis of the existing process, identifying bottlenecks and areas for improvement. This often requires input from all stakeholders involved, from frontline employees to management. It’s important to map out each step, noting the inputs required, the outputs generated, and the individuals or teams responsible for each task. Focusing on eliminating redundant steps and automating repetitive tasks is crucial. A clear understanding of the current state is the foundation upon which optimization efforts are built.
Identifying Key Performance Indicators
To measure the success of any workflow improvement initiative, it’s vital to establish Key Performance Indicators (KPIs). These metrics provide tangible evidence of progress and allow for data-driven decision-making. Common KPIs include cycle time (the time it takes to complete a process), error rates, customer satisfaction scores, and cost per transaction. The specific KPIs will vary depending on the nature of the workflow, but they should always be aligned with overarching business objectives. Regular monitoring of these metrics is essential to identify areas where further adjustments are needed. Without quantifiable data, it’s difficult to objectively assess the impact of changes and justify continued investment in workflow optimization.

Leveraging Technology for Automation
Automation is a cornerstone of modern workflow optimization. Identifying tasks that can be automated—such as data entry, email responses, and report generation—can free up valuable time for employees to focus on more strategic activities. Robotic Process Automation (RPA) and intelligent automation tools are becoming increasingly sophisticated, capable of handling complex tasks with minimal human intervention. However, it’s important to approach automation strategically, focusing on areas where it will deliver the greatest return on investment. Thorough testing and validation are crucial to ensure that automated processes are accurate and reliable. Automation isn’t about replacing people; it’s about empowering them to do their jobs more effectively.
- Prioritize tasks based on impact and feasibility.
- Select automation tools that integrate seamlessly with existing systems.
- Provide adequate training to employees on how to use the new tools.
- Monitor automated processes closely to identify and address any issues.
- Continuously evaluate opportunities for further automation

The Role of Collaboration and Communication
Even the most meticulously designed workflow can falter without effective collaboration and communication. Breaking down silos between departments, fostering open dialogue, and encouraging knowledge sharing are all essential ingredients for success. Regular team meetings, collaborative document editing, and instant messaging platforms can all facilitate better communication. It’s also important to establish clear channels for escalation, so that issues can be addressed promptly and effectively. A culture of transparency and accountability is crucial. Everyone should understand their role in the process and feel empowered to speak up if they encounter problems. This builds trust and fosters a sense of shared ownership, leading to better outcomes.

Managing Change and Resistance
Implementing a new system, even one designed to improve efficiency, inevitably encounters resistance to change. Individuals may be comfortable with the existing way of doing things and hesitant to embrace new processes. Addressing this resistance requires open communication, empathy, and a focus on the benefits of the new system. Clearly articulate the reasons for the change and how it will benefit both the organization and the individuals involved. Provide adequate training and support to help employees adapt to the new processes. Involve employees in the implementation process, soliciting their input and addressing their concerns. Celebrating early successes can build momentum and encourage broader adoption. Strong leadership is essential to guide the organization through the change process and overcome any obstacles.
